Output af90f88f0db63a2d8a8bd034e3b6c40002fa84c32888e8a3b80bce222ec596e5:53

value
2668418
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a549eed914fc3cc6fdc54b98de949d0cc9114ad OP_EQUALVERIFY OP_CHECKSIG
address
17n2Nkeg91VxghJ79aq3quzw9QArnkPq4i
transaction
af90f88f0db63a2d8a8bd034e3b6c40002fa84c32888e8a3b80bce222ec596e5
confirmations
249354
spent
true